The synthesis of 1,2-Dichloro-1,1-difluoroethane, often referred to as HCFC-132b, can be achieved through several routes. Common starting materials include compounds like 2-Chloro-1,1-difluoroethylene or 1,1,1,2-Tetrachloroethane. These synthesis routes are detailed in chemical literature, such as the reference in Tetrahedron, 22, p. 1747 (1966), indicating its established presence in chemical research. The efficiency and purity of the final product are crucial, with typical purity requirements being 95%min.

Historically, HCFC-132b found application as a refrigerant. Its physical properties, such as a boiling point of 46-47°C and a density of 1.416 g/cm³, made it suitable for certain cooling systems. However, due to its classification as an ozone-depleting substance, its use in this capacity has been significantly curtailed under international environmental agreements like the Montreal Protocol.

Beyond its past use as a refrigerant, 1,2-Dichloro-1,1-difluoroethane also serves as a valuable intermediate in organic synthesis. Its difluorinated and chlorinated structure makes it a useful building block for creating more complex fluorinated organic compounds, which are vital in the development of pharmaceuticals, agrochemicals, and advanced materials. Researchers exploring novel synthesis methods might find HCFC-132b a key reagent for introducing specific halogenated functionalities into target molecules.
